Mala Strana

Malá Strana „Mala Strana (Little Side, formerly Little Town) - a district of Prague, until 1784 an independent town located at the foot of the Prague Castle, on the left bank of the Vltava River. In 1784, Mala Strana, along with other historical districts, became the nucleus of a united Prague, an...
